What is the correct size for the cover photo of your Facebook page in 2021?

With Facebook changing the layout and the sizes of the cover photo, it’s a little tricky to create the perfect responsive Facebook cover photo for your business page that looks great on desktop and mobile alike.

Facebook Access By Device

According to Hootsuite, by January 2020, 98% of Facebook users are accessing Facebook via any kind of mobile device.

Therefore, we recommend to optimizing the photo for mobile first with the different desktop size in mind.

Facebook Cover Photo Size

The problem is that the cover photo has a different shape in mobile vs desktop. On mobile they are taller, while the desktop has a wider aspect ratio.

Facebook cover photo size graphic

So, you can design for mobile and allow for some cropping on the top and bottom of the photo on desktop, or design for desktop and have a portion of the sides cropped off on mobile. Mobile use is on the rise, and this trend will continue to grow. Google won’t like your website if it’s not optimized for mobile – and Facebook users won’t understand your cover photo that’s designed only for desktop viewing!

Therefore, considering the high percentage of mobile users, we highly recommend designing for mobile first.

Facebook Cover Photo - Mobile vs Desktop

The image below shows an overlay of our cover photo on mobile vs desktop. This is what our cover photo looks like on both devices.  We opted for the display of the entire photo on mobile (red box), while the black box shows the part that is shown on a desktop. As you can see, a portion of top and bottom are cut off and the sides are filled with a gradient.

The challenge is that Facebook adds a gradient to both sides of the desktop cover and if you don’t have a solid color, but actually a photo, it might not look so good. Facebook is pulling a color from the top outer edges of your cover image. And if the image is different on either side, then the gradient is too.

Recommended Facebook Cover Photo Size

The trick is to make your image taller than the recommended 820 x 312 pixels. Try 461 pixels tall. The crop on desktop is now only 303 tall if you go with the 820 pixels width. This gives you 79 pixels on top and bottom that will be cropped on desktop.

So, size-wise you can go either with the lower resolution of 820 x 461 pixels, or the higher resolution of 1200 x 675 pixels, and plan for the design of your cover to also work with the pixels that will be cropped on desktop.

The ideal image size for your Facebook cover photo is 851 x 315 pixels.For best results make sure that the file format is .jpg, RGB color, and less than 100KB.
